Transaction 2e21cc960160ec3dc5d84b717ad8a6afd5fac7630983e8f620d11d52e84d106a
1 Input
2 Outputs
- 2e21cc960160ec3dc5d84b717ad8a6afd5fac7630983e8f620d11d52e84d106a:0
- 2e21cc960160ec3dc5d84b717ad8a6afd5fac7630983e8f620d11d52e84d106a:1
value 8281711
address 1DkDbrjr9CwZzKCZMNk2xMTVLMbbqc8hPF
value 19808018
address 1Jb436tRCPE2NLtZ67oTPkBB53AXZtuPsM